At State of Play, Sony unveiled a brand new DualSense Wireless Controller commemorating the anniversary.

Its crimson and white color scheme mirrors the Ghost of Sparta's pale skin and bright tattoo. Santa Monica Studio's Design Director Dela Longfish explained how the project took shape on the PlayStation Blog.

"When we were deciding how best to embody the series, we immediately thought the form of the controller lent itself perfectly to Kratos’ omega tattoo," Longfish said. "No matter which God of War game you’re playing, the shape of his red ink against the gray of his ash-covered skin is one of the most iconic elements of Kratos’ look across both Greek and Norse sagas. Our team made sure to represent both of these key tones in the color selection for the controller to make every aspect an authentic homage to the design that has defined Kratos for over two decades."

This looks like a thing I'll be buying. It will be available in limited quantities for a recommended retail price of $84.99. Pre-orders will start Oct. 3 at 10 am local time at direct.playstation.com and participating retailers. The actual launch will be Oct. 23.
